dc.description.abstractActive noise cancellation of audio signals, which has been the subject of a substantial quantity of research in the past, remains a significant obstacle in many aspects of acoustic signal processing. In a natural environment, the system’s parameters are in constant flux. Consequently, we shall investigate the filtered-x least mean square (FxLMS) algorithm. The adaptive filter is used as a controller to generate an anti-noise signal in the feedforward FxLMS algorithm, which only addressed narrowband and broadband noise. The feedback FxLMS algorithm, on the other hand, enhances the algorithm’s convergence, but cannot eliminate the effect of residual noise’s uncorrelated disturbance. However, both the correlated and uncorrelated disturbances must be under user control. Therefore, a combination of the feedback and feed-forward FxLMS algorithms was employed, which consists of two portions for estimating the primary disturbances and the uncorrelated disturbances. A variable step size algorithm has been employed to attain a balance between system stability and control efficiency. In Akhtar’s method, an external adaptive filter was applied to the feed-forward system in order to estimate a more precise error signal and enhance the performance of the systems. These improvements will improve the algorithm’s ability to control both primary and uncorrelated noise.
